Synopsis

THE 158-POUND MARRIAGE is an erotic--and ironic-- love story by the author of the best selling THE WORLD ACCORDING TO GARP. John Irving looks beyond the eye-catching gyrations of the mating dance and beyond the theatrics of body contact and love to the morning-after complications. THE 158-POUND MARRIAGE is everything you've always known about sex and were afraid to admit.

From the Inside Flap

"Irving looks cunningly beyond the eye-catching gyrations of the mating dance to the morning-after implications."
--The Washington Post

The darker vision and sexual ambiguities of this erotic, ironic tale about a ménage a quatre in a New England university town foreshadow those of The World According to Garp; but this very trim and precise novel is a marked departure from the author's generally robust, boisterous style. Though Mr. Irving's cool eye spares none of his foursome, he writes with genuine compassion for the sexual tests and illusions they perpetrate on each other; but the sexual intrigue between them demonstrates how even the kind can be ungenerous, and even the well-intentioned, destructive.

"One of the most remarkable things about John Irving's first three novels, viewed from the vantage of The World According to Garp, is that they can be read as one extended fictional enterprise. . . . The 158-Pound Marriage is as lean and concentrated as a mine shaft."
--Terrence Des Pres
